สร้างความคิดเห็นระดับบนสุดใหม่ หากต้องการเพิ่มการตอบกลับความคิดเห็นที่มีอยู่ ให้ใช้เมธอด comments.insert
แทน
ผลกระทบของโควต้า: การเรียกใช้วิธีการนี้มีค่าใช้จ่ายโควต้า 50 หน่วย
Use Case ทั่วไป
ส่งคำขอ
คำขอ HTTP
POST https://www.googleapis.com/youtube/v3/commentThreads
การให้สิทธิ์
คำขอนี้ต้องได้รับการให้สิทธิ์อย่างน้อย 1 ขอบเขตต่อไปนี้ (อ่านเพิ่มเติมเกี่ยวกับการตรวจสอบสิทธิ์และการให้สิทธิ์)
ขอบเขต |
---|
https://www.googleapis.com/auth/youtube.force-ssl |
พารามิเตอร์
ตารางต่อไปนี้แสดงพารามิเตอร์ที่การค้นหานี้รองรับ พารามิเตอร์ทั้งหมดที่แสดงอยู่เป็นพารามิเตอร์การค้นหา
พารามิเตอร์ | ||
---|---|---|
พารามิเตอร์ที่จำเป็น | ||
part |
string พารามิเตอร์ part จะระบุพร็อพเพอร์ตี้ที่การตอบกลับจาก API จะรวมไว้ด้วย ตั้งค่าพารามิเตอร์เป็น snippet ส่วน snippet มีค่าใช้จ่ายโควต้า 2 หน่วยรายการต่อไปนี้มีชื่อ part ที่คุณสามารถรวมในค่าพารามิเตอร์
|
เนื้อหาของคำขอ
ระบุทรัพยากรcommentThreadในเนื้อหาคำขอ
สำหรับทรัพยากรนั้น คุณต้องระบุค่าสำหรับพร็อพเพอร์ตี้ต่อไปนี้
snippet.channelId
snippet.videoId
snippet.topLevelComment.snippet.textOriginal
คำตอบ
หากสำเร็จ เมธอดนี้จะแสดงทรัพยากรcommentThreadในเนื้อหาการตอบกลับ
ข้อผิดพลาด
ตารางต่อไปนี้ระบุข้อความแสดงข้อผิดพลาดที่ API อาจแสดงผลเพื่อตอบสนองต่อการเรียกเมธอดนี้ โปรดดูรายละเอียดเพิ่มเติมในเอกสารประกอบข้อความแสดงข้อผิดพลาด
ประเภทข้อผิดพลาด | รายละเอียดข้อผิดพลาด | คำอธิบาย |
---|---|---|
badRequest (400) |
channelOrVideoIdMissing |
ชุดข้อความของความคิดเห็นแต่ละชุดต้องลิงก์กับวิดีโอ ตรวจสอบว่าทรัพยากรระบุค่าสำหรับพร็อพเพอร์ตี้ snippet.channelId และ snippet.videoId ความคิดเห็นเกี่ยวกับวิดีโอจะปรากฏบนหน้าดูวิดีโอ |
badRequest (400) |
commentTextRequired |
ทรัพยากร comment ที่จะแทรกต้องระบุค่าสำหรับพร็อพเพอร์ตี้ snippet.topLevelComment.snippet.textOriginal ต้องระบุความคิดเห็น |
badRequest (400) |
commentTextTooLong |
ทรัพยากร comment ที่แทรกมีอักขระในพร็อพเพอร์ตี้ snippet.topLevelComment.snippet.textOriginal มากเกินไป |
badRequest (400) |
invalidCommentThreadMetadata |
ข้อมูลเมตาของคำขอไม่ถูกต้อง |
badRequest (400) |
processingFailure |
เซิร์ฟเวอร์ API ดำเนินการตามคำขอไม่สำเร็จ แม้ว่านี่อาจเป็นข้อผิดพลาดชั่วคราว แต่โดยปกติแล้วจะระบุว่าอินพุตของคำขอไม่ถูกต้อง ตรวจสอบโครงสร้างของทรัพยากร commentThread ในเนื้อหาคำขอเพื่อให้แน่ใจว่าถูกต้อง |
forbidden (403) |
forbidden |
สร้างชุดความคิดเห็นไม่ได้เนื่องจากมีสิทธิ์ไม่เพียงพอ คำขออาจไม่ได้รับอนุญาตอย่างถูกต้อง |
forbidden (403) |
ineligibleAccount |
บัญชี YouTube ที่ใช้เพื่อให้สิทธิ์คำขอ API ต้องผสานรวมกับบัญชี Google ของผู้ใช้เพื่อแทรกชุดความคิดเห็นหรือชุดความคิดเห็น |
notFound (404) |
channelNotFound |
ไม่พบแชแนลที่ระบุ ตรวจสอบว่าค่าของพร็อพเพอร์ตี้ snippet.channelId ถูกต้อง |
notFound (404) |
videoNotFound |
ไม่พบวิดีโอที่ระบุ ตรวจสอบว่าค่าของพร็อพเพอร์ตี้ snippet.videoId ถูกต้อง |
ลองใช้เลย
ใช้ APIs Explorer เพื่อเรียกใช้ API นี้เพื่อดูคำขอและการตอบสนองของ API